Hi @Jsuth19, Looks like you need to increase the flow of the caulking product by cutting the nozzle down. This will give you a larger bead of caulk that will fill the gap. Apply a large bead and then smooth it off whilst contouring it around the aggregate. I'd suggest popping on some gloves and using your finger dipped in soapy water.
